Metacam solution for injection contains Meloxicam as it's active ingredient, and is indicated for injectable use. There are multiple different bottle sizes and concentrations depending on the species being treated.
Active Ingredient
Meloxicam

Can you give metacamfor horse's to dogs and how much in food
The concentration of Meloxicam within Metacam for horses compared to Metacam for dogs varies greatly and so it is strongly advised not to mix the two. They are also not licensed for use in the other species and so we cannot legally advise this use.
This is a prescription only medication so you should discuss any dose queries with your prescribing vet.

What ailments is Metacam used for in cattle
Metacam is a Non-Steroidal Anti-Inflammatory Drug (an NSAID). This means it used to to reduce inflammation and so provide pain relief. Common uses include pain relief for wounds or reducing inflammation with muscular/joint/skeletal disorders. It is a prescription only medication so you will need a written prescription to purchase it from us, and it should only be used alongside your prescribing vet's advice.
